

If you do not have a payment gateway enabled but still want your client to be able to view the Web Invoice you’ll need to add a link for the Web Invoice to your invoice message. Keep in mind that if you have online payments enabled for your account, it’s not possible to send a Web Invoice with online payments disabled. You'll also see an option to preview the Web Invoice next to that. If you have an online payment gateway enabled in your account there will be a checkbox to include the link to the Web Invoice when you’re sending the invoice. If you have the client dashboard enabled in your account, your clients will find a link to their dashboard on the Web Invoice. Also, when a client views a Web Invoice, you’ll see a notification in the Invoice history. The Web Invoice will always show the current version of the invoice if changes are made. To add people to the list of recipients, you’ll need to create additional client contacts. When you send an invoice or estimate, you have the option to choose multiple recipients. To remove as many potential roadblocks as possible, we recommend that clients add to the list of addresses they can receive emails from. If an invoice or estimate fails to be delivered, Harvest will notify you via email so that you can follow up with your client and resend the invoice. We set your email address as the reply-to address so that when a client replies, their message will be sent directly to you. When you send invoices and estimates to your clients via Harvest, the emails will display your name but always come from (see this FAQ for more information on why).
